The Costa Rica Sea Turtle program offers you an amazing opportunity to engage with Costa Rica’s immense biodiversity. From our field station, you’ll monitor the beach, guided by trained research assistants. You’ll also step into the lowland rainforests, exploring and learning about the unique flora and fauna of the jungle.
The Costa Rica Felines and Primates program focuses on the monkeys, jungle cats, and sea turtles of the area. You’ll set out to explore the rainforest, setting camera traps to monitor the behaviors of jaguars and other felines. Collect observational data on the three species of primates, studying their abundance, eating habits, and social structure. On the beach, you’ll monitor nests and collect data on endangered leatherback sea turtle hatchlings.
